Mohamed Diawara's ‘love' for defense is the upside behind Knicks' draft gamble

The newest Knick understands where his bread is buttered. 'I just love defense,' Mohamed Diawara, who was drafted by the Knicks on Thursday, said in a recent interview with Off The Grid Fitness. 'That's not the job that everybody wanna do. But I feel like it can really, really bring you some money if you could do it good. 'So you got to be a great defender and I feel like what's motivating me is I just want to play at the highest level. And I know for me to play at the highest level, I have to be a great defender. That's what motivates me.' The defensive element — along with Diawara's athleticism and the potential to stash him overseas if necessary — carried the Knicks' decision to make an upside gamble on the 20-year-old Frenchman.

Samba Diawara appointed Reims head coach

In a press conference held today, the Stade de Reims general manager, Mathieu Lacour announced that Samba Diawara had been confirmed as the club's next permanent head coach. Diawara had been acting as the interim head coach since the 3rd of February when he replaced Luka Elsner. However, what had looked like a temporary role until the club found a new figurehead has now become concrete, with Lacour stating 'This is neither an interim nor a temporary choice until the end of the season: Samba is the coach of the professional team, with a long-term vision for the role and our collaboration.' Diawara has overseen three games for Reims since Elsner was fired from the position following a poor run of form in the league (winless since the 24th of November). Results haven't immediately improved and Reims are yet to score under their new head coach. A 0-0 draw with amateur side Bourgoin-Jallieu in the Coupe de France (Reims winning on penalties 3-2) was followed by defeats to Olympique Lyonnais (4-0) and Angers SCO (1-0). The club are into the quarter-finals of the cup, but sit only four points above the relegation playoff spot with 12 games remaining. GFFN | Nick Hartland
